Output efc072c51f00aeeaaa60acc84f3236d23e90551b109ca7d97b202c201a7daf1c:9

value
90868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af67fe5a57bf667a66a67efdb9023dd307fc7b9 OP_EQUAL
address
3P7PLXNJYeHw6Pc8K8P6jLR13AUxVSiJeQ
transaction
efc072c51f00aeeaaa60acc84f3236d23e90551b109ca7d97b202c201a7daf1c